Class CategorySettingDAOHibernate
java.lang.Object
com.softslate.commerce.daos.core.BaseDAO
com.softslate.commerce.daos.product.CategorySettingDAOHibernate
- All Implemented Interfaces:
DAOInterface
,CategorySettingDAO
public class CategorySettingDAOHibernate
extends BaseDAO
implements DAOInterface, CategorySettingDAO
Generic DAO to manage the
sscCategorySetting
table of the
database.- Author:
- David Tobey
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ate CategorySetting
(package private) static org.apache.commons.logging.Log
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
void
deleteCategorySetting
(boolean commit) void
void
insertCategorySetting
(boolean commit) void
void
setCategorySetting
(CategorySetting categorySetting) void
void
updateCategorySetting
(boolean commit) Methods inherited from class com.softslate.commerce.daos.core.BaseDAO
deleteObject, doWorkToSetConnection, editAssignment, evictCache, formatDateTime, getAppComponents, getAppSettings, getConnection, getDaoFactory, getDAOUtils, getDataSource, getImportExportSQL, getImportExportSqlMap, getInjector, getNamedQuery, getSettings, getSQL, getSqlMap, initialize, insertObject, loadAll, loadAll, loadObject, parseDateTime, setAppComponents, setAppSettings, setConnection, setDaoFactory, setDAOUtils, setDataSource, setImportExportSqlMap, setInjector, setSettings, setSqlMap, updateObject
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face com.softslate.commerce.daos.core.DAOInterface
deleteObject, formatDateTime, getAppComponents, getAppSettings, getConnection, getDaoFactory, getDAOUtils, getDataSource, getInjector, getSettings, getSqlMap, initialize, insertObject, loadAll, loadAll, loadObject, parseDateTime, setAppComponents, setAppSettings, setConnection, setDaoFactory, setDAOUtils, setDataSource, setInjector, setSettings, setSqlMap, updateObject
-
Field Details
-
log
static org.apache.commons.logging.Log log -
categorySetting
-
-
Constructor Details
-
CategorySettingDAOHibernate
public CategorySettingDAOHibernate()
-
-
Method Details
-
getCategorySetting
- Specified by:
getCategorySetting
in interfaceCategorySettingDAO
-
setCategorySetting
- Specified by:
setCategorySetting
in interfaceCategorySettingDAO
-
loadCategorySettingFromID
- Specified by:
loadCategorySettingFromID
in interfaceCategorySettingDAO
- Throws:
Exception
-
insertCategorySetting
- Specified by:
insertCategorySetting
in interfaceCategorySettingDAO
- Throws:
DataAccessException
-
insertCategorySetting
- Specified by:
insertCategorySetting
in interfaceCategorySettingDAO
- Throws:
DataAccessException
-
updateCategorySetting
- Specified by:
updateCategorySetting
in interfaceCategorySettingDAO
- Throws:
DataAccessException
-
updateCategorySetting
- Specified by:
updateCategorySetting
in interfaceCategorySettingDAO
- Throws:
DataAccessException
-
deleteCategorySetting
- Specified by:
deleteCategorySetting
in interfaceCategorySettingDAO
- Throws:
DataAccessException
-
deleteCategorySetting
- Specified by:
deleteCategorySetting
in interfaceCategorySettingDAO
- Throws:
DataAccessException
-